As the world navigates the ever-evolving terrain of artificial intelligence (AI), its influence on various sectors—particularly in defense—continues to expand. One prominent voice in this conversation is Shyam Sankar, Chief Technology Officer at Palantir Technologies, a company known for its data analytics platforms and deep ties to government defense and intelligence agencies. In a recent interview, Sankar offered an exclusive look into the transformative role of AI in shaping modern defense strategies, reflecting on the potential future of the Pentagon under a Trump administration. His insights provide a clear vision of how AI can redefine national security, defense technologies, and military operations.

The Strategic Role of AI in National Defense

Artificial intelligence is no longer a speculative technology; it has become a practical tool driving key advancements in defense strategies globally. AI’s integration into defense sectors promises to streamline intelligence gathering, enhance operational efficiency, and provide an edge in the rapidly evolving landscape of global security threats.

Sankar’s work at Palantir, a company that specializes in big data and analytics, underscores the pivotal role that AI plays in enabling better decision-making in complex military and intelligence operations. The vast amounts of data that modern militaries collect, from satellite imagery to intercepted communications, require advanced AI systems to process and analyze in real-time, enabling faster and more accurate decisions on the battlefield.

AI-powered systems are already being employed to sift through enormous datasets and identify critical patterns that may otherwise be overlooked. The use of AI for predictive analytics has further revolutionized defense strategies by enabling military forces to anticipate enemy movements and actions. By utilizing machine learning and neural networks, AI can also predict possible future conflicts based on historical data and ongoing geopolitical developments, making it an invaluable tool for defense planners and military strategists.

Shyam Sankar’s Vision for the Future of Defense Innovation

Shyam Sankar’s vision for defense innovation, especially within the context of Palantir’s technologies, revolves around two major themes: the fusion of AI with big data and the democratization of intelligence. According to Sankar, AI is crucial for transforming raw, unstructured data into actionable intelligence, providing military leaders with a comprehensive understanding of both the battlefield and the broader strategic environment.

Palantir’s cutting-edge software integrates vast datasets with real-time analytics, enabling defense and intelligence agencies to make data-driven decisions faster than ever before. AI plays a central role in this process, helping analysts identify trends, pinpoint emerging threats, and make predictions with unprecedented accuracy.

Beyond AI’s practical applications, Sankar highlights the ethical and societal implications of leveraging such powerful technologies in national defense. As defense systems grow increasingly reliant on AI, the question of how much autonomy to grant these systems becomes critical. Could AI eventually be entrusted with the decision-making authority to engage in military operations without human oversight? This question remains one of the most pressing debates in the intersection of AI and defense policy.

The Potential Impact of a Trump-Led Pentagon on Defense AI

The potential re-emergence of former President Donald Trump at the helm of the Pentagon raises questions about how defense innovation might evolve, particularly regarding the implementation of AI technologies. Under the Trump administration, there was a marked push for modernizing the U.S. military, with an emphasis on technological superiority. The Trump administration also focused on ensuring that the U.S. maintained a competitive edge over adversaries like China and Russia in the realm of defense innovation.

In a hypothetical second term, it is likely that Trump would continue to prioritize AI as a cornerstone of national defense strategy, pushing for accelerated development and deployment of AI systems within the military. Sankar’s comments indicate that such a shift could result in a dramatic acceleration of AI adoption, including the increased automation of defense technologies. Whether this would involve autonomous drones, robotic soldiers, or AI-powered strategic command systems, the implications for the future of warfare could be profound.

One of the challenges in adopting AI at such a scale is ensuring that these technologies are robust, ethical, and capable of functioning in complex environments. As AI is integrated into defense systems, there will be a need for oversight and regulation to avoid unintended consequences, such as AI systems making incorrect decisions due to faulty algorithms or biased data. Moreover, the ongoing arms race in AI development may lead to heightened global tensions, with countries seeking to outpace one another in the field of defense AI.

Palantir’s Rising Stock and Its Strategic Role in Defense Innovation

Palantir Technologies, the company behind many of the AI-driven innovations in the defense and intelligence sectors, has seen its stock price surge in recent years, reflecting growing investor confidence in its long-term potential. This rise comes as the company’s AI-driven platforms become increasingly integral to national security efforts around the world. Palantir’s success is tied to its ability to provide highly specialized, customizable software solutions that enable government agencies to make data-driven decisions, particularly in defense and intelligence.

The company’s prominence in the defense sector raises questions about the potential future role of private companies in national security efforts. As companies like Palantir continue to push the envelope in AI and big data analytics, they may increasingly take on more responsibility in shaping defense strategy. This shift towards private sector involvement in defense innovation could lead to greater collaboration between the military and tech companies, creating new opportunities for both sectors.

Broader Implications of AI in Defense and Security

The growing reliance on AI in defense is not without its broader implications, particularly when considering the global balance of power. Nations around the world are investing heavily in AI, and whoever leads in AI development is poised to dominate not only in military contexts but also in economic and geopolitical spheres.

In addition to the military advantages AI offers, the technology could also serve as a key tool in counterterrorism efforts, disaster relief, and border security. The ability to analyze real-time data for potential threats or emergencies could revolutionize how governments respond to crises, potentially saving lives and reducing the impacts of natural disasters or terrorist attacks.

On the other hand, the widespread deployment of AI-powered defense technologies could lead to an escalation in global arms races. As countries compete to build the most advanced AI systems, this could trigger a cycle of technological proliferation that may lead to greater global instability. Additionally, there are concerns about the potential misuse of AI, including the development of autonomous weapons that could be used in unethical or destabilizing ways.
